Energy conservation and energy efficiency are two important concepts when it comes to reducing energy consumption. They are different, but both involve changing behavior and lifestyles to use less energy. Both strategies also work to protect the environment.
When people think about energy conservation, they usually picture switching off appliances and lights when they aren’t in use. These actions are not necessarily the only ones that will make a difference. However, they are effective and easy to do. Whether you’re looking to save money, improve your home’s value, or preserve your appliances, these simple measures are a great way to start.
Energy efficiency, on the other hand, focuses on using technology and innovative materials to reduce the amount of energy that you need to perform the same tasks. Typically, it involves replacing your old appliances and light bulbs with new, more energy-efficient products. Similarly, energy-efficient technologies include smart house hubs, smart refrigerators, and LEDs. This technology helps you save money, save the environment, and improve the quality of your life.
Depending on the size of your home, the number of appliances you own, and the type of products that you use, the amount of energy you consume each day will vary. Some of the easiest ways to conserve energy in your home are unplugging small appliances and turning off lights when they’re not in use. In addition, you can invest in solar panels to help harness the power of the sun.

Residential Electricians in Las Vegas install, repair, and maintain electrical systems in homes. They may perform a variety of tasks, including installing outlets and light fixtures, upgrading electrical panels, and repairing or replacing circuit breakers that have been damaged by overloads or other problems. These professionals can also assist with the installation of smart home devices, security systems, and backup generators. Other common services include installing whole-home surge protectors to protect appliances and electronics from power spikes, replacing or testing hardwired smoke detectors, and providing EV charging stations for homeowners with electric vehicles.
Installing New Outlets
While some homeowners attempt to add new outlets themselves, this can be a complex project that requires a permit and compliance with wiring standards. It can also be dangerous if the homeowner doesn’t understand the wiring or isn’t familiar with proper installation techniques. A professional electrician can ensure that the new outlets are properly installed and tested for safety.
Replacing Light Fixtures
Many homeowners think that replacing a light fixture is an easy DIY project, but this can be complicated by existing wiring issues and unforeseen challenges like drywall that needs to be cut to accommodate the new fixture. It’s also important to choose the right fixture and use proper installation techniques to avoid damage to drywall or drywall joints. Electricians have the tools and experience to handle these projects safely and quickly.
